So the concept was simple after hearing her tell me about how the song came about:
"I wrote Silk's Funk Factory for my mom. Back in the day Silk was her nickname. You know, I never asked her where she got the nickname. But, growing up in the Delaney Projects of Gary, Indiana I just always remember our house being the spot where my mom and her friends would just let loose and party. My mom also had this plaque that looked like a piece of driftwood and it had the words "Silk's Funk Factory" etched into it and it was always hanging somewhere, on the door, the wall. I am so glad that my mom got a chance to come down and portray Silk in the video. She loved that moment! " ~ Timeca M. Seretti

What else needs ta be said? Hm, for the film/video peeps this was shot entirely on a DJI Osmo with an X5R head. My favorite thing to shoot with these days. Able to do lots of subtle floaty Steadicam-like shots, reposition, run around the club getting various angles, and really shined when Timeca walks off stage towards the camera and the subsequent dance scene.
